70% of Americans, Including 55% of Republicans, Now Want Legal Weed in America According to a New Gallup Poll

The recent Gallup poll, revealing a historic 70% nationwide support for U.S. marijuana legalization, signifies a transformative moment in societal acceptance of cannabis. The data’s detailed exploration of age groups, political affiliations, and regional differences illuminates a nuanced narrative, underlining the widespread nature of this evolving consensus.
